Principal's Message

Dear Families
Recently we received a summary report relating to the 2025 School Satisfaction Survey. This year 93 parents and carers took the opportunity to provide us with feedback on what the school does well and where we may improve. Our results were once again extremely positive and above the Tasmanian average. The MHPS average rating was 8.4, the Tasmanian average rating was 7.2 Ratings are out of 10.
Some of our highlights include:
Item MHPS TAS
People from diverse backgrounds are respected in this school 8.8 7.4
I can talk to my child's teachers about my concerns 8.8 8.0
I would recommend this school to others 8.8 7.5
Staff at this school expect my child to do their best 8.8 7.9
Staff at this school work with me to support my child's learning 8.7 7.2
I can help my child with reading at home 8.7 8.4
My child feels safe at this school 8.6 7.4
Staff at this school motivate my child to learn 8.6 7.4
The school embraces the DECYP values of Connection, Courage, Growth, Respect and Responsibility 8.6 7.4
Staff at this school treat students fairly 8.5 7.2
This school is well maintained 8.5 7.7
My child is making good progress at this school 8.5 7.3
Staff are interested in my child's wellbeing 8.5 7.5
Teachers at this school provide my child with useful feedback about their learning progress 8.5 7.2
I know how the school helps my child learn to read 8.5 6.9
This school looks for ways to improve 8.4 7.2
There is effective educational leadership in this school 8.4 6.9
Students with disability are supported with appropriate educational adjustments at this school 8.3 6.8
My child's report and communication with teachers gives me a good understanding about their learning progress and achievement 8.3 6.9
My child likes being at this school 8.3 7.5
Staff help my child to be responsible for their own learning 8.3 7.3

Our three lowest scores indicating areas for consideration are:

Item MHPS TAS
I can help my child with maths at home 7.9 7.5
I know how the school helps my child learn in maths 7.8 6.6
I feel like I am part of my school community 7.6 6.5

Thank you very much for your feedback. As a school we will carefully consider our results, and continue to build on our strengths and address areas for improvement.
